Orion777 replied: "Coffee has more caffeine than tea. Coffee 150 ml (5 oz) 60-150 mg. of caffeine Coffee, decaf 150 ml (5 oz) 2-5 mg. of caffeine Tea 150 ml (5 oz) 40-80 mg. of caffeine Tea: Caffeine content is also affected by the length of the infusion in water. Black tea infused for 5 minutes yields 40-100 milligrams, whereas a 3-minute infusion produces 20-40 milligrams, or half as much. Twenty cups of green tea yield 240 milligrams, or about 12 milligrams per cup. In massive doses, caffeine is lethal. A fatal dose of caffeine has been calculated to be more than 10 grams (about 170 mg/kg body weight) - this is the same as drinking 80 to 100 cups of coffee in rapid succession - not an easy thing to do. Caffeine enters the bloodstream through the stomach and small intestine and can have its effects as soon as 15 minutes after it is consumed. Once in the body, caffeine will stay around for hours: it takes about 6 hours for one half of the caffeine to be eliminated."

How does caffeine, the coffee flavor and aroma get transferred to hot coffee? Since water is a polar liquid and the soluble fractions of coffee grounds are non polar... how is the caffeine, flavor and aroma transferred to hot coffee? In chemical terms..

Gabry Hyrule replied: "Solubility is relative. Saying that something is soluble in something is just saying that LARGE amount of it will get in the solution. Obviously, even if you put a 20-carbon alkane into water, you WILL have some molecules of the hydrocarbon here and there in the water. When you look at caffeine, sure it's not too polar, but it can do lots of H-bonds. Even if it doesn't help that much, caffeine will be solvated to some extent by the water. The quantity of caffeine you actually WANT to drink is lower than what you could put in solution. In tea, it's about 1g/100mL water, and that's enough for a normal beverage. Caffeine is a poisonous alkaloid after all. Obviously, caffeine is sovated more easily in hot water than in cold water, and that's probably why humans drink hot coffee, as opposed to cool coffee (new trends)."

Does flavored coffee have enough caffeine in it? I have to start getting up at 6 in the morning when skool starts and I feel horrible and tiered during the day. I hate energy drinks and the taste of reg coffee. Does flavored (vanilla, chocolate) coffee have the same amount of caffeine as regular coffee?

Ask And I Shall Answer !! replied: "Sure does........however, brewed tea has more caffeine in it than an equal amount of coffee."

buttercup_baby replied: "yup same amount... and if u wanna save money i can give a little recipe on how to make cold coffee or fraps for when its still hot out... just blend one half a cup of coffe half a cup of milk, three tbl spoons of sugar three tbl spoons or carmale or chocolate (your choice) and two cups of ice its great! :)"

Someone I know was wondering replied: "Yes sir! You can stay awake all night with flavor!"

Amanda replied: "Flavored coffee is made the same way as regular coffee with artificial flavorings added. So yes, same amount of caffeine or even higher. Coffee is unusual in that cheap, nasty robusta coffee has more caffeine than good arabica coffee, so it's conceivable that a company using cheap, nasty blends for flavored coffees and relying on the flavorings to compensate would produce flavored coffees with more caffeine than the normal version. To clarify the first person's answer, tea leaves, ounce for ounce, have much more caffeine than coffee beans. And if you brewed tea using 10 grams of ground-up leaves per cup and let it sit five minutes, you'd get more caffeine in your cup of tea too. However, if you brewed tea with standard coffee measures like that you'd get an undrinkable concoction; tea is meant to be brewed at 1/5 that strength, 2g leaves per cup, and so the actual amount of caffeine in the cup of tea you drink is less than a cup of coffee. (There is cosmic balance; it's easy to get 8-12 pleasant cups of tea out of an amount that would only make 1 cup of coffee, and those 8 cups would get you more buzzed if you drank them all at once.)"
